Age | Commit message (Collapse) | Author | |
---|---|---|---|
2023-12-12 | Remove default kernel configuration | Timo Wilken | |
2023-12-12 | Move to latest kernel on lap | Timo Wilken | |
2023-12-11 | Serve "proper" git HTTPS remote on git.twilken.net | Timo Wilken | |
...and move cgit to cgit.twilken.net to accommodate this. | |||
2023-12-07 | Thermald does not support AMD CPUs | Timo Wilken | |
2023-11-30 | Tweak cgit overview page | Timo Wilken | |
2023-11-29 | Give cgit automatic access to git repos | Timo Wilken | |
2023-11-29 | Fix cgit clone prefixes | Timo Wilken | |
2023-11-29 | Serve Git repos over SSH and back them up | Timo Wilken | |
2023-11-29 | Serve cgit on git.twilken.net | Timo Wilken | |
2023-11-29 | Migrate Nextcloud from Apache to nginx | Timo Wilken | |
2023-11-22 | Remove obsolete comment | Timo Wilken | |
2023-11-22 | Unify system declarations for lap and frm | Timo Wilken | |
2023-11-22 | Move to ed25519 SSH keys on end-user devices | Timo Wilken | |
2023-11-21 | Allow SSH access to end-user machines | Timo Wilken | |
This is useful for communicating between the two laptops. | |||
2023-11-21 | Update installer systems | Timo Wilken | |
As used during installation of frm.twilken.net. | |||
2023-11-21 | Install MT7922 firmware on Framework laptop | Timo Wilken | |
2023-11-21 | Enable MT7921E module for AMD RZ616 Wi-Fi card | Timo Wilken | |
2023-11-20 | Manage new Framework laptop | Timo Wilken | |
2023-11-20 | Make WireGuard service install its own secrets automatically | Timo Wilken | |
2023-11-08 | Fix copy-pasted Wireguard keys on lud | Timo Wilken | |
2023-11-08 | Track secrets on lud | Timo Wilken | |
2023-11-08 | Track restic and wireguard secrets on vin | Timo Wilken | |
2023-11-08 | Use age for secrets encryption | Timo Wilken | |
2023-11-05 | Add secrets service | Timo Wilken | |
Allow managing secrets and passwords using Guix. Secrets are encrypted in the Guix channel repository and decrypted using a single host key at activation time. | |||
2023-11-02 | Back up Grafana database | Timo Wilken | |
2023-11-01 | Revoke Syncopoli's SSH keys | Timo Wilken | |
I don't use this app for backing up my phone any more (instead, I use restic). Disable the access granted to the SSH key formerly used by Syncopoli. | |||
2023-11-01 | Fix path to public key file for moved installer declaration | Timo Wilken | |
2023-11-01 | Generalise Restic declarations | Timo Wilken | |
* rename confusingly named restic-*-repository variables to restic-scheduled-* * generalise repository handling, allowing local and REST repositories both as backup and cleanup targets * generalise password handling, allowing passwords from pass or from files for backup, for cleanup and as part of a REST URL | |||
2023-11-01 | Add a simple test script | Timo Wilken | |
This only evaluates each home and system config to make sure they're valid. Move the "nonfree installer" declaration to a subdirectory since evaluating it does too much -- it seems to trigger a "guix pull" somehow. | |||
2023-10-28 | Store Nextcloud backups in restic repo | Timo Wilken | |
Replace the Nextcloud backup shell script with a Guile program that writes to a restic repository instead. | |||
2023-10-16 | Set WiFi regulatory domain on connection | Timo Wilken | |
2023-10-08 | Use dirty, proprietary NVIDIA driver | Timo Wilken | |
For hopefully better gaming performance. | |||
2023-10-07 | Update lud resources and add comment about new Guix feature | Timo Wilken | |
2023-09-12 | Dynamically set vin's IPv6 address | Timo Wilken | |
2023-09-12 | Add Mythic dynamic DNS service | Timo Wilken | |
2023-09-11 | Wait for backlight to come up before setting it | Timo Wilken | |
2023-09-08 | Remove unused and obsolete X modules | Timo Wilken | |
2023-09-08 | Run cleanup for OAndBackupX backups later | Timo Wilken | |
2023-09-08 | Clean up new "sync" restic repo | Timo Wilken | |
2023-09-02 | Enable scanning using sane-airscan + ipp-usb | Timo Wilken | |
This allows using my scanner properly, since I haven't connected it to the network. | |||
2023-08-10 | Keep fewer Signal backups | Timo Wilken | |
Don't need so many. | |||
2023-07-04 | Manually set backlight through /sys | Timo Wilken | |
This should avoid xbacklight's XRandR errors on boot. | |||
2023-07-02 | Set backlight on laptop startup | Timo Wilken | |
2023-06-06 | Use new screen-locker syntax for lap | Timo Wilken | |
2023-06-05 | Fix screen-locker-configuration syntax | Timo Wilken | |
2023-06-04 | Fix typo in offloading setup | Timo Wilken | |
Also, only offload to vin at home, not lud, to avoid having to upload stuff over a slow link. | |||
2023-06-04 | Set up offloading from laptop to servers | Timo Wilken | |
2023-06-03 | Indent *-file functions more conveniently | Timo Wilken | |
Files with potentially long or complex contents shouldn't be indented quite as far. | |||
2023-06-03 | Install and enable php-imagick for Nextcloud | Timo Wilken | |
2023-05-28 | Restart services on unattended-upgrade | Timo Wilken | |